**Mgmt Meeting Minutes — Retiring the Brightline Range**

Quick recap for sales leads at Fenholt Supplies: we agreed to retire the Brightline fixture range by year-end. Remaining stock moves to clearance pricing next month, and accounts on standing orders get migrated to the Lumetta range. Trade-in incentives were approved in principle. The confidential note on next steps sits just below.

board note of bajof-bajeg: The pricing group signed off on a budget of $13.4 million for Project Sildor. The renewal with Lamixek Holdings closes at $48.9 million a year, 49 percent above the last contract.

### Step 4 – Enable payload compression

The Glintrail telemetry pipeline now compresses payloads before they land in the events store. After deploying the new collector, confirm that the `compressed` flag appears on incoming rows and that legacy uncompressed rows still decode correctly. Run the verification script against a small batch first; it is idempotent. New team members should use the staging database for this check, reachable via the connection string below.

replica DSN, kajep-yahag: mssql://praok_svc:iF@db-8d68.plorvaio.local:5432/eliion

Subject: Handover — Fernloop bloom filter tuning

Hi Asta,

The bloom filter fronting the Fernloop KV store was resized last night; false-positive rate dropped from 4% to 0.7%, and read amplification looks healthy. Rebuild completes around noon. I'll summarize at the weekly sync. For questions before then, contact the storage on-call directly.

billing contact of kahif-kagug = tameth@paliqforge.example

Handover note — Crumbwheel order cutoffs.

Welcome aboard. The bakery cutoff rule in Crumbwheel closes same-day orders at 14:00 local to each storefront, not UTC — this has bitten us twice. Holiday overrides live in the calendar service and take precedence silently, so always check there first when a cutoff looks wrong. To unlock the calendar service's admin console after a restart, enter the recovery passphrase below.

vault phrase of bagap-bahaf = silion-pelox-sorox-casdor-quenwyn-fraax-eliox-praael-kelion-quenvan-kasox-rusael-norius-belvan